HUBS Hedge Fund Activity: Q3 2024 in Review
724 of the 6,964 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in HubSpot (HUBS) for Q3 2024, worth a combined $24.5B — down 9.4% from $27B a quarter earlier.
Sellers outnumbered buyers: 142 funds closed out of HUBS and 76 opened new positions — a net loss of 66 holders — while 257 trimmed existing stakes and 275 added.
The largest buyer was T. Rowe Price Associates, adding an estimated $1.32B. The largest seller was Franklin Resources, cutting an estimated $250M.
